With a focus on encouraging students to think creatively, critically, and empathetically while caring for and supporting the development of the whole child, it is no wonder that Waldorf education is one of the fastest-growing independent school movements in the world. By emphasizing imagination, teachers who leverage this approach are better equipped to support students as they develop important artistic and social skills while also developing the skills to be free thinkers with a strong sense of moral responsibility.
